I.7 VISCOSITY AND TEMPERATURE DISPLAY
Viscosity is displayed in either P=Poise or cP=Centipoise (CGS system) or
Pa•s=Pascal seconds or mPa•s=milliPascal seconds (SI system). If the viscosity
measurement is over range, “EEEE” will be displayed. BYK-Gardner recommends a
minimum reading of 10%. If the display value is between 0 and 10%, the unit display
willashtoindicateanoutofrangecondition.Iftheviscometersettlesoutwitha
nalreadingbelowzero,negativevalueswillbedisplayed.
Temperature is displayed in °C=degrees centigrade.
I.8 Cleaning
Instrument, Keypad & Painted Surfaces:
Clean with dry, non-abrasive cloth.
Do not use solventsor cleaners.
Immersed Components (spindles/cones) and insulation plate:
All immersed components are made of carbide steel.
Clean with non-abrasive cloth and solvent appropriate for sample material
that is not aggressive to immersed components.
NOTE: When cleaning, take care not to apply excessive force which may
bend the spindle shaft or otherwise damage the instrument.
